Fire Trucks! Monster Trucks! Big Rigs and more!The Junior League of Texarkana will hold its sixth annual "Touch a Truck" festival on Saturday, April 11, from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. at Front Street Plaza in downtown Texarkana.

The event will feature big rigs, emergency vehicles, construction equipment and more.

There will also be costumed characters, face painting, safety demonstrations, balloon artists, and performances by local children's groups. Free construction hats will go to the first 250 kids of the day and free goody bags for the first 200 kids who turn in their cards showing they visited all of the trucks.

The "Touch a Truck" event helps the Junior League of Texarkana support its mission and community projects while also providing families the opportunity to learn about and explore trucks, construction vehicles and public safety equipment. All proceeds go to programs benefiting our local children.
